E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
模板方法
设计模式【行为型】--
模板方法
模式
模板方法
模式(Templatemethodpattern)
模板方法
模式是一种行为型设计模式,它定义了一个操作中的算法骨架,将一些步骤的具体实现延迟到子类中。
暴躁的菜鸡
·
2023-07-16 19:40
Java设计模式
设计模式
模板方法模式
python
模版模式在Spring中的应用
何为模版模式经典
模板方法
定义:父类定义了骨架(调用哪些方法及顺序),某些特定方法由子类实现。最大的好处:代码复用,减少重复代码。除了子类要实现的特定方法,其他方法及方法调用顺序都在父类中预先写好了。
爱琴孩
·
2023-07-16 18:18
spring
Spring
JdbcTemplate
模版模式
设计模式(二十二)-----模板模式(Template Pattern)
什么是
模板方法
模式:
模板方法
是基于继承实现的,在抽象父类中声明一个
模板方法
,并在
模板方法
中定义算法的执行步骤(即算法骨架)。
皆是梦
·
2023-07-15 18:52
设计模式
设计模式
C#设计模式之---
模板方法
模式
模板方法
模式(TemplateMethodPattern)
模板方法
模式(TemplateMethodPattern)定义了一个算法的步骤,并允许子类为一个或多个步骤提供其实现方式。
忧郁的蛋~
·
2023-07-15 06:12
C#遗忘系列
设计模式
模板方法模式
设计模式——命令模式
例如与责任链模式结合,实现命令族解析任务;结合
模板方法
模式,可
加把劲骑士RideOn
·
2023-07-15 02:14
设计模式
设计模式
命令模式
模板模式(上):剖析模板模式在JDK、Servlet、JUnit等中的应用
模板模式的原理与实现
模板方法
模式在一个方法中定义一个算法骨架,并将某些步骤推迟到子类中实现。
模板方法
模式可以让子类在不改变算法整体结构的情况下,重新定义算法中的某些步骤。原理很简单,代码实现就
兜兜转转m
·
2023-07-14 19:18
设计模式
java
开发语言
【c++设计模式】——
模板方法
模式
模板方法
模式的定义定义一个操作中的算法对象的骨架(稳定),而将一些步骤延迟到子类(定义一个虚函数,让子类去实现),templatemethod使得子类可以不改变(复用)一个算法结构即可重定义该算法的某些步骤
努力学习的少年
·
2023-06-24 11:59
设计模式
设计模式
模板方法模式
设计模式
1.策略模式2.
模板方法
3.代理模式cglib:继承一个类时,生成该类的代理类采用cglib。
这是给你机会向
·
2023-06-24 08:55
设计模式之
模板方法
模式笔记
设计模式之
模板方法
模式笔记说明TemplateMethod(
模板方法
)目录
模板方法
模式示例类图抽象类包菜类菜心类测试类说明记录下学习设计模式-
模板方法
模式的写法。JDK使用版本为1.8版本。
谁不想飞舞青春
·
2023-06-24 07:05
设计模式
设计模式
模板方法模式
java
后端
如何在flutter页面中应用
模板方法
设计模式?
模板方法
模式的定义和组成
模板方法
模式是一种只需使用继承就可以实现的非常简单的模式。
模板方法
模式由两部分结构组成,第一部分是抽象父类,第二部分是具体的实现子类。
七分小熊猫
·
2023-06-24 04:43
5.JAVA
模板方法
模式总结
这篇文章介绍一种笔者认为最最最简单的设计模式,
模板方法
模式。
ironman327
·
2023-06-23 19:51
设计模式笔记
文章目录设计模式笔记一、创建型模式工厂方法抽象工厂生成器原型单例二、结构型模式适配器桥接装饰代理三、行为模式迭代器观察者
模板方法
设计模式笔记这个只能理解记忆,很多时候有些结构容易记混淆,结合例子记忆会好些
monkeyhlj
·
2023-06-22 19:32
Java学习
设计模式
java
Java设计模式——备忘录模式【Memento Pattern】
11种(行为型模式):策略模式、
模板方法
模式、观察者模式、迭代器模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。行为型又可以通过类与类之间的关系进行划
止步前行
·
2023-06-22 10:58
设计模式
java
设计模式
备忘录模式
AQS原理
目录一、原理概述二、AQS对资源的共享方式三、AQS底层使用了
模板方法
模式四、使用demo,使用AQS实现不可重入锁五、AQS使用到的几个框架一、原理概述AQS全称是AbstractQueuedSynchronizer
林汐的学习笔记
·
2023-06-21 18:36
Java多线程
java多线程
js设计模式思想与实现
结构型模式2.1装饰器模式72.2适配器模式82.3代理模式92.4桥接模型102.5组合模式113行为(关系)型模式3.1观察者模式123.2发布订阅模式133.3模块模式143.4命令模式153.5
模板方法
模式
勉灬之
·
2023-06-21 15:31
javascript
设计模式
各用一句话总结23种设计模式
种:适配器模式、桥接模式、组合模式、装饰器模式、外观模式、享元模式、代理模式行为型模式,共11种:责任链模式、命令模式、解释器模式、迭代器模式、中介者模式、备忘录模式、观察者模式、状态模式、策略模式、
模板方法
模式
KevinAha
·
2023-06-21 07:03
设计模式
模板方法
-
适用场景:1、一次性实现一个算法不变的部分,并将可变的行为留给子类来实现2、各子类中公共的行为被提取出来并集中到一个公共的父类中,从而避免代码重复优点:1、利用
模板方法
将相同处理逻辑的代码放到抽象父类中
愿好
·
2023-06-20 23:14
模板方法模式
模版方法模式在 JDK 及 spring 源码中的引用
模版方法模式
模板方法
模式是一种行为设计模式,它在超类中定义了一个算法的框架,允许子类在不修改结构的情况下重写算法的特定步骤。
悄悄地努力
·
2023-06-20 16:50
设计模式
java
spring
开发语言
java spi 扩展_【扩展和解耦】JAVA原生SPI实现插件扩展
2.实现扩展性的方式和插件的应用场景插件提供了扩展性,实现扩展性的方式还有很多,例如:1.
模板方法
设计模式通过子类实现父类
耿直的波为
·
2023-06-20 11:30
java
spi
扩展
万字详解常用设计模式
>设计模式一共有23种,本文讲解涉及如下:>1.责任链模式>2.
模板方法
模式>3.发布订阅模式>4.策略模式##三大分类业界一般将设计模式分为三大类:-**创建型模式**:
waynaqua
·
2023-06-19 22:00
万字详解常用设计模式
设计模式一共有23种,本文讲解涉及如下:责任链模式
模板方法
模式发布订阅模式策略模式三大分类业界一般将设计模式分为三大类:创建型模式:对类的实例化过程进行了抽象,能够将软件模块中对象的创建和对象的使用分离
waynaqua
·
2023-06-19 07:01
java
开发语言
设计模式
Java设计模式
/聚合复用原理23种设计模式介绍1.单例模式2.原型模式3.工厂方法模式4.抽象工厂模式5.建造者模式6.代理模式7.适配器模式8.桥接模式9.装饰模式10.外观模式11.享元模式12.组合模式13.
模板方法
模式
周广亚732
·
2023-06-18 23:06
java
设计模式
开发语言
模板方法
模式
一.定义
模板方法
模式(TemplateMethodPattern〉是如此简单,以致让你感觉你已经能够掌握其精髓了。
忘忧记
·
2023-06-18 20:10
设计模式
模板方法模式
C++ 设计模式学习
文章目录1、设计原则1.1、依赖原则1.2、开放封闭1.3、面向接口1.4、封装变化点1.5、单一职责1.6、里氏替换1.7、接口隔离1.8、组合优于继承2、
模板方法
2.1、定义2.2、背景2.3、要点
讳疾忌医丶
·
2023-06-18 10:07
Linux
系统编程
c++
设计模式
学习
C++基础-设计模式学习
*1.高层实现不能依赖于底层实现,而只能依赖底层抽象;*2.抽象不能依赖于实现,而是实现依赖抽象;*///
模板方法
TemplateMethod,通过抽象了过程,提供切入方法,完成晚绑定的调用方式(即框架类自动调用应用程序开发者所继承实现的方法
阿卢说他遇到阿玮
·
2023-06-18 09:18
编程
c++
设计模式
Python设计模式——行为型模式
目录责任链模式观察者模式策略模式
模板方法
模式责任链模式内容:使多个对象都有机会处理请求,从而避免请求的发送者和接收者之间的耦合关系。
脑汁
·
2023-06-18 00:44
设计模式
python
设计模式
开发语言
访问者模式(Visitor)
参考:
模板方法
设计模式(refactoringguru.cn)design-patterns-cpp/TemplateMethod.cppatmaster·JakubVojvoda/design-patterns-cpp
baboon_chen
·
2023-06-17 15:30
设计模式
访问者模式
c++
设计模式
模板方法
模式(Template Method)
参考:
模板方法
设计模式(refactoringguru.cn)design-patterns-cpp/TemplateMethod.cppatmaster·JakubVojvoda/design-patterns-cpp
baboon_chen
·
2023-06-17 15:00
设计模式
模板方法模式
c++
设计模式
设计模式期末总结
设计模式简要说明创建型工厂方法模式抽象工厂模式建造者模式原形模式单例模式结构型模式适配器模式桥接模式组合模式装饰模式外观模式享元模式代理模式行为型模式职责链模式命令模式解释器模式迭代器模式中介者模式备忘录模式观察者模式状态模式策略模式
模板方法
模式访问者模式简要说明这份文档是针对设计模式的一次期末总结
Thomas_cannon
·
2023-06-15 19:04
期末总结
设计模式
设计模式—
模板方法
模式
模板方法
模式:定义一个操作的流程框架,而将流程中一些步骤延迟到子类中实现。使得子类在不改变流程结构的情况下,重新定义流程中的特定步骤。
hello_gogogo
·
2023-06-15 06:22
设计模式
设计模式
模板方法模式
23种设计模式概念
9.门面模式10.工厂方法模式11.享元模式12.解释器模式13.迭代器模式14.中介者模式15.备忘录模式16.观察者模式17.原型模式18.代理模式19.单例模式20.状态模式21.策略模式22.
模板方法
模式
Siveens
·
2023-06-15 03:56
设计模式
设计模式
模板方法
模板方法
模式是一种简单而常见的设计模式,在许多软件开发场景下都得到了广泛应用。在这篇博客中,我们将使用ChatAI作为助手详细解析
模板方法
模式。
会飞的晨蕊
·
2023-06-14 05:33
设计模式
设计模式
c++
Chat
AI
经典的设计模式13——
模板方法
模式
文章目录
模板方法
模式开始11个属于行为型模式的复习。
模板方法
模式用户登录控制功能用
模板方法
实现。
暗紫色的乔松(-_^)
·
2023-06-14 03:58
设计模式
设计模式
模板方法模式
java
设计模式(十三):行为型之
模板方法
模式
设计模式系列文章设计模式(一):创建型之单例模式设计模式(二、三):创建型之工厂方法和抽象工厂模式设计模式(四):创建型之原型模式设计模式(五):创建型之建造者模式设计模式(六):结构型之代理模式设计模式(七):结构型之适配器模式设计模式(八):结构型之装饰器模式设计模式(九):结构型之桥接模式设计模式(十):结构型之外观模式设计模式(十一):结构型之组合模式设计模式(十二):结构型之享元模式设计
冬天vs不冷
·
2023-06-14 01:25
设计模式
设计模式
模板方法模式
java.util.concurrent.AbstractExecutorService
java.util.concurrent.AbstractExecutorService是一个抽象类,它实现了java.util.concurrent.ExecutorService接口,并提供了一些默认的方法和
模板方法
monicateacat
·
2023-06-13 19:01
java
数学建模
开发语言
详解模板模式
模板模式中有两个角色:抽象类(AbstractClass):定义
模板方法
,描述算法的骨架,包含了一系列的步骤,并且有一些步骤是抽象方法,需要由子类实现。实现类
_BugMan
·
2023-06-13 14:57
JAVA
SE
java
开发语言
Java-Servlet解析
文章目录前言Servlet定义内部解析总结servlet接口实际应用的servletGenericServlet类和HttpServlet类HttpServlet中的设计模式首先看一下
模板方法
的定义逐步解析
皮卡冲撞
·
2023-06-13 02:18
servlet
java
tomcat
初识Javascript 设计模式
行为型模式,共十一种:策略模式、
模板方法
模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。还有两类:并发型模式和线程池模式。
大龙BBG
·
2023-06-12 16:23
模板方法
模式
什么是
模板方法
?即让工作或流程顺序按照写好的模板进行下去,同时还可以自定义流程,以及简化流程。
西敏寺钟声
·
2023-06-11 18:57
设计模式:创建型设计模式、结构型设计模式
设计模式基础设计原则一.创建型设计模式1.
模板方法
2.观察者模式3.策略模式二.结构型设计模式1.单例模式2.工厂模式3.抽象工厂4.责任链5.装饰器6.组合模式前言如何学习设计模式?
Polymer to C++
·
2023-06-11 08:16
新手入门
笔记
设计模式
C++设计模式-
模板方法
Template Method Pattern
//下面是一个使用
模板方法
设计模式的代码示例://```cpp//#include//抽象基类#includeclassCaffeineBeverage{public:virtual~CaffeineBeverage
guoguo0524
·
2023-06-10 07:49
c++
模板方法
模式(Template Method Pattern) C++
上一节:工厂模式(FactoryPattern)C++文章目录1.理论2.实践1.理论
模板方法
模式(TemplateMethodPattern)是一种行为设计模式,用于定义一个算法的骨架,将一些步骤的实现延迟到子类中
yaoyaohyl
·
2023-06-09 08:08
设计模式
c++
模板方法模式
设计模式
建造者模式(Builder Pattern)C++
上一节:
模板方法
模式(TemplateMethodPattern)C++文章目录1.理论2.实践1.理论建造者模式(BuilderPattern)是一种创建型设计模式,旨在通过逐步构建复杂对象来解决对象创建过程的灵活性和可扩展性问题
yaoyaohyl
·
2023-06-09 08:53
设计模式
c++
设计模式
建造者模式
IOC源码解析
目录主要从3方面进行解析Bean与BeanDefinition容器初始化主要做的事情(主要脉络)BeanFactoryApplicationContext
模板方法
模式Resource、ResourceLoader
兔子队列
·
2023-06-08 20:59
Spring源码
spring
java
spring
boot
源码
Spring+SpringMVC+SpringBOOT 框架
Spring里用的最经典的一个设计模式就是:
模板方法
模式。(这里我都不介绍了,是一个很常用的设计模式),Sprin
Dgg0911
·
2023-06-08 18:46
spring
JAVA 23种设计模式【深度了解】
行为型模式:共十一种:策略模式、
模板方法
模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式。其实还有两类:并发型模式和
Sunrise'
·
2023-06-08 12:45
JAVA开发笔记
设计模式
java学习干货
java
设计模式
开发语言
模板方法
设计模式的学习和使用
1、
模板方法
设计模式的学习 当涉及到一系列具有相似行为的算法或操作时,
模板方法
设计模式是一种有效的设计模式。它允许你定义一个算法的骨架,同时将某些步骤的实现细节交给子类来实现。
minyunfei6
·
2023-06-08 08:45
设计模式
设计模式
学习
java
模板方法模式
java设计模式(十四)
模板方法
目录定义模式结构角色职责代码实现适用场景优缺点定义
模板方法
模式(TemplateMethodPattern),又叫模板模式(TemplatePattern),指在一个抽象类公开定义了执行它的方法的模板。
走进IT
·
2023-06-08 03:49
设计模式
java
设计模式
开发语言
永不磨灭的设计模式(23种设计模式全集)
桥接模式8、组合模式9、装饰器模式10、外观模式11、享元模式12、代理模式13、责任链模式14、命令模式15、迭代器模式16、中介者模式17、备忘录模式18、观察者模式19、状态模式20、策略模式21、
模板方法
模式
Owen Guo
·
2023-06-08 02:11
设计模式
设计模式
java
代码演示
详解Java实现单例模式(面试题)懒汉式饿汉式
行为型模式,共11种:策略模式、
模板方法
模式、观察者模式、迭代器
豆恭梓
·
2023-06-07 22:06
Java面向对象
java
单例模式
开发语言
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他